May 2025 - Apr 2026Weston Street area has the 7th highest crime rate of 38 local areas in Palfrey , and the 183rd highest crime rate of 827 local areas in Walsall .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Weston Street (WS1 4EE) in the last 12 months was 128.7 per 1,000 residents and was 60.9% higher than the Palfrey average (80.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 15 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Robbery 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 17 (≈ 62.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-19.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-67.7%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Weston Street (WS1 4EE),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 123 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Grange Street (22 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
